Output 3841b63e2e3c9931f7315d38c87e22fbc672658d6375053e44b33bda61eed068:5

value
309546661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 168b390a7851210a7d9d8ef685396892658c44f8 OP_EQUAL
address
33kDa8mwRnsgsXUeiRTFxMiufEnzuyrkkg
transaction
3841b63e2e3c9931f7315d38c87e22fbc672658d6375053e44b33bda61eed068
spent
true